1. What’s in a Name? Sacai’s Origins 🌸

First things first: Sacai is more than just another high-fashion buzzword—it’s a cultural phenomenon born out of Japan. Founded by Chitose Abe in 1999, Sacai quickly became known for its avant-garde designs that blend utility with elegance. But here’s where the drama starts… how exactly do you pronounce it?

3. Why Does It Matter Anyway? 🧐

At first glance, arguing over pronunciations may seem trivial, but language shapes identity—and brands thrive on connection. Mispronouncing Sacai could alienate fans who value authenticity while pleasing others who prioritize accessibility. So, what’s the verdict?
Chitose Abe herself clarified during interviews that the proper way to say it is indeed "sa-KAI." Boom. Case closed—or so we thought. Yet, old habits die hard, and plenty of influencers still call it "sa-sigh." Go figure! 😅
